I'm a TAA recipient, laid off in 2016. I'm in CA. On our UE website, there are TAA application forms. I submitted those to start the process. I checked online for your state laworks.net and didn't find forms but if you search TAA, instructions say to apply at a Job Center. Same website has a link to find the Job Center in your area. UE and TAA work together but separate in CA. It might be like that in your state. If your UE office has a "Special Services" department, try them. It was a process to get the ball rolling but worth the effort. I'm in school and receive TAA/UE benefits while training. I hope this helps and good luck!
